This volume contains a collection of protocols from some of the
major laboratories involved in stem cell research across the world.
The research discussed in this book covers topics such as:
isolating, characterizing and expanding dental pulp stem cells;
manipulating the proliferative potential of cardiomyocytes by gene
transfer; isolation of stromal stem cells from adipose tissue;
noninvasive assessment of cell fat and biology in transplanted
mesenchymal stem cells; and cell-free therapy for organ repair.
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ology
series format, chapters include introductions to their respective
top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ents,
step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and tips
on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ls. Cutting-edge and
thorough, Adult Stem Cells: Methods and Protocols is a valuable
resource for helping researchers transform the study of stem cells
into an industrialized process that will supply patients with
efficient, safe, and cost-effective cell treatments.
